A Graduate Certificate in Ethical Perspectives on Genetic Engineering provides focused training in the complex ethical considerations surrounding advancements in biotechnology and genetic modification. The program delves into the philosophical, social, and legal implications of genetic technologies, equipping students with a critical understanding of this rapidly evolving field.
Learning outcomes typically include a mastery of key ethical frameworks applicable to genetic engineering, the ability to analyze complex case studies involving genome editing, CRISPR technology, and gene therapy, and the development of effective communication skills to engage in public discourse on these sensitive issues. Students will also gain proficiency in bioethics research methods.
The duration of such a certificate program usually varies but often ranges from 9 to 12 months of part-time study or 6 months of full-time study, depending on the institution. This flexible structure accommodates working professionals seeking to upskill or change careers.
This Graduate Certificate holds significant industry relevance. Graduates are well-positioned for careers in bioethics consulting, regulatory affairs within the biotechnology sector, scientific journalism focused on genetic technologies, and research roles at universities and think tanks grappling with the ethical implications of genetic engineering. Knowledge of biotechnology policy and law is a valuable asset in these roles.
The Graduate Certificate in Ethical Perspectives on Genetic Engineering offers a pathway to contribute to responsible innovation in this transformative area of science and technology, addressing the ethical challenges posed by genetic engineering and its profound societal impacts. The program may involve case studies on human genetic modification, agricultural applications, and intellectual property issues in the field.
